The New Internet Games in Windows 7

    The New Internet Games in Windows 7


    Posted: 20 Feb 2009
    If you’re running the Windows 7 Beta and hadn’t already noticed, we are introducing 3 new Windows Games for Windows 7.

    Internet Backgammon:


    Internet Checkers:


    Internet Spades:


    These games were well liked in Windows XP. Due to the amount of requests we received, we are bringing them back!

    The new versions of these games have been completely redesigned and improved over their old-school predecessors. With each game, you can:


    • Play online against human opponents (up to 4 players at the same time with Internet Spades).
    • Select from 3 skill levels to be matched with similarly skilled players from all around the world.
    • If your opponent drops out, a computer opponent takes over to finish the game.
    • Choose from cool different backgrounds and piece/card designs.
    And as I mentioned in my post about Games Explorer, you can track statistics for games played as well.
